#include "hphp/util/compatibility.h"
#include "hphp/util/vdso.h"
namespace HPHP {
///////////////////////////////////////////////////////////////////////////////
#if defined(__APPLE__)
char *strndup(const char* str, size_t len) {
size_t str_len = strlen(str);
if (len < str_len) {
str_len = len;
}
char *result = (char*)malloc(str_len + 1);
if (result == nullptr) {
return nullptr;
}
memcpy(result, str, str_len);
result[str_len] = '\0';
return result;
}
int dprintf(int fd, const char *format, ...) {
va_list ap;
char *ptr = nullptr;
int ret = 0;
va_start(ap, format);
vasprintf(&ptr, format, ap);
va_end(ap);
if (ptr) {
ret = write(fd, ptr, strlen(ptr));
free(ptr);
}
return ret;
}
#endif
int gettime(clockid_t which_clock, struct timespec *tp) {
#if defined(__APPLE__)
// XXX: OSX doesn't support realtime so we ignore which_clock
struct timeval tv;
int ret = gettimeofday(&tv, nullptr);
tp->tv_sec = tv.tv_sec;
tp->tv_nsec = tv.tv_usec * 1000;
return ret;
#else
static int vdso_usable =
Util::Vdso::ClockGetTime(which_clock, tp);
if (vdso_usable == 0)
return Util::Vdso::ClockGetTime(which_clock, tp);
return clock_gettime(which_clock, tp);
#endif
}
int64_t gettime_diff_us(const timespec &start, const timespec &end) {
int64_t dsec = end.tv_sec - start.tv_sec;
int64_t dnsec = end.tv_nsec - start.tv_nsec;
return dsec * 1000000 + dnsec / 1000;
}
///////////////////////////////////////////////////////////////////////////////
}
